Charging the unit
Connect the unit and the computer booted using the micro-USB cable
supplied.
Micro-USB cable (supplied)
When the unit and the computer are connected, charging starts and
the indicator (red) lights up.
Charging is completed in about 1.5 hours at most and the indicator
(red) goes off automatically.
Use the micro-USB cable supplied. You may not be able to charge the unit with
other cables.
Pairing and
c
onnecting with the BLUETOOTH device
Before pairing, charge this unit.
1
Place the BLUETOOTH device within 1 meter (3 feet) of this
unit.
2
Enter pairing mode on this unit.
Blue
Red
Press and hold the
POWER
button for more than 7 seconds.
Make sure that the indicator flashes
blue and red alternately after you
release the button.
3
Perform the pairing procedure on the BLUETOOTH device
to detect this unit.
When the list of detected devices appears on the display of the
BLUETOOTH device, select “MDR-AS700BT.”
If passkey input is required on the display of a BLUETOOTH device,
input “0000.”
4
Make the BLUETOOTH connection from the BLUETOOTH
device.
Connecting with the paired device
1
Turn on the unit.
Blue
Press and hold the
POWER
button for about 2 seconds.
Make sure that the indicator flashes
blue after you release the button.
2
Make the BLUETOOTH connection from the BLUETOOTH
device.
Listening and Calling
Operate the unit after making BLUETOOTH connection with your BLUETOOTH
device.
Listening to music
Profile: A2DP, AVRCP
Start playback on the BLUETOOTH device.
POWER
Play/pause: Press POWER.
Volume: Press VOL
+/.
Next/previous: Press VOL
+/ until a beep sounds.
Fast forward/fast reverse: Hold VOL
+/ down.
The sound quality is set to the standard mode (SBC high quality mode) before
shipment. When you connect a BLUETOOTH device compatible with AAC, you
can change the setting as described in the Help Guide to enjoy music playback
at a higher level of sound quality.
Making a call/Receiving a call
Profile: HSP, HFP
Operate your mobile phone to make a call.
Press the
POWER button on the unit
when an incoming call arrives.
Operate in the same way when an incoming call
arrives while you are listening to the music.
The music playback pauses during a call and
resumes automatically when the call is over.
To terminate a call, press the
POWER button on
the unit.
Volume for a call and listening to music can
be adjusted independently.

One-touch connection with a smartphone (NFC)
NFC (Near Field Communication) is a technology enabling short-range
wireless communication between various devices, such as mobile phones
and IC tags. Thanks to the NFC function, data communication can be
achieved easily just by touching the relevant symbol or designated
location on NFC compatible devices.
By using the NFC function, the unit is turned on automatically and then
paired and connected with a BLUETOOTH device.
Compatible smartphones
Smartphones with the NFC function built-in
(OS: Android 2.3.3 or later, excluding Android 3.x)
